The Twisted Metal series will always have a place in PlayStation history. In the early years of the PSone, the successful vehicular combat game brought attention to a console trying to establish its identity. After creator David Jaffe left, the series floundered with two disappointing 989 Studios installments...

The latest Twisted Metal trailer looks at the backstory of Mr. Grimm sung to the rocking tunes of Rob Zombie's Dragula, a song that released in 1998. There isn't much narrative to be drawn from the trailer, but you do get a decent helping of gameplay footage. Twisted Metal is set for release...
